Struct TextSpan
Pôvodný názov: Aspose.Html.Toolkit.Markdown.Syntax.Text Zhromaždenie: Aspose.HTML.dll (25.4.0)
Predstavuje textový spánok.
[ComVisible(true)]
public struct TextSpan : IEquatable<textspan>, IComparable<textspan>
Implements
Z dedičných členov
object.GetType()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Constructors
TextSpan(a int, int)
Vytvorte TextSpan
public TextSpan(int start, int length)
Parameters
start
int
Začiatok je .
length
int
v dĺžke .
Exceptions
Hrať, ak argumenty sú mimo dosahu.
Properties
End
Získajte finálny index.
public int End { get; }
Hodnota nehnuteľnosti
Length
Dajte si dĺžku.
public int Length { get; }
Hodnota nehnuteľnosti
Start
Získajte začiatočný index.
public int Start { get; }
Hodnota nehnuteľnosti
Methods
Combine(TextSpan, TextSpan)
Kombinuje textové špany
public static TextSpan Combine(TextSpan left, TextSpan right)
Parameters
left
TextSpan
V ľavom textovom spánku.
right
TextSpan
Správny text spánok.
Returns
Kombinácia textového spánku.
CompareTo(TextSpan)
Porovnajte s inými TextSpan
public int CompareTo(TextSpan other)
Parameters
other
TextSpan
Druhý text spánok.
Returns
Počiatočná pozícia rozdielu.
Create(a int, int)
Vytvorte TextSpan
public static TextSpan Create(int start, int length)
Parameters
start
int
Začiatočná pozícia .
length
int
v dĺžke .
Returns
a textový spánok.
CreateEmpty()
Vytvorte prázdny textový priestor.
public static TextSpan CreateEmpty()
Returns
a textový spánok.
CreateEmpty(int)
Vytvorte prázdny TextSpan z počiatočnej polohy.
public static TextSpan CreateEmpty(int start)
Parameters
start
int
Začiatočná pozícia .
Returns
a textový spánok.
CreateFromStartEnd(a int, int)
Vytvorte TextSpan
public static TextSpan CreateFromStartEnd(int start, int end)
Parameters
start
int
Začiatočná pozícia .
end
int
Na konci pozície.
Returns
a textový spánok.
Equals(TextSpan)
Porovnajte s inými TextSpan
public bool Equals(TextSpan other)
Parameters
other
TextSpan
Ďalšie TextSpan
Returns
V prípade, že oba textSpan sú rovnaké.
Equals(objekty)
Porovnanie s inými objektmi
public override bool Equals(object obj)
Parameters
obj
object
Druhý objekt
Returns
V prípade, že oba textSpan sú rovnaké.
GetHashCode()
Získajte hashcode
public override int GetHashCode()
Returns
a hash kódov.
IsEmpty()
Vráťte pravdu, ak je dĺžka = 0.
public bool IsEmpty()
Returns
To je booleánska hodnota.
ToString()
Príspevok v téme ToString() override
public override string ToString()
Returns
Výsledok je prúžok.
Operators
prevádzkovateľ = =(TextSpan, TextSpan)
Prejdite cez = = prevádzkovateľa.
public static bool operator ==(TextSpan left, TextSpan right)
Parameters
left
TextSpan
V ľavom textovom spánku.
right
TextSpan
Správny text spánok.
Returns
Je pravda, že ľavica je rovnaká ako pravica.
prevádzkovateľ !=(TextSpan, TextSpan)
Prepáčte sa! = prevádzkovateľ
public static bool operator !=(TextSpan left, TextSpan right)
Parameters
left
TextSpan
V ľavom textovom spánku.
right
TextSpan
Správny text spánok.
Returns
Je pravda, že ľavica nie je rovnaká ako pravica.